Vice-presidents Pension Act, 1997 Section 6

Title: Power to Remove Difficulties

State: Central

Year: 1997

1[6. Power to remove difficulties.- (1) If any difficulty arises in giving effect to the provisions of this Act as amended by the Vice-President's Pension (Amendment) Act, 2008, the Central Government may, by order, do anything not inconsistent with such provisions for the purpose of removing the difficulty: Provided that no such order shall be made after the expiration of two years from the date on which this Act comes into force. (2) Every order made under sub-section (1) shall be laid before each House of Parliament.] _________________________ 1. Inserted by the Vice-Presidents Pension (Amendment) Act, 2008.

Lalit Kala Akadami Taking over of Management Act, 1997 Section 6

Title: Relinquishment of Administration of the Society

State: Central

Year: 1997

(1) Notwithstanding anything contained in sub-section (1) of section 3, if, at any time before the expiry of the period referred to in that sub-section, it appears to the Central Government that the purposes of the vesting of the management of the society in that Government have been fulfilled or that for any other reason it is not necessary that the management of the society should remain vested in that Government, it may, by order published in the Official Gazette, relinquish the management of the society with effect from such date as may be specified in the order. (2) On and from the date specified under sub-section (1), the administration of the society shall vest in the General Council of the society and such management shall he carried on in accordance with the provisions of the Societies Registration Act so, however, that the steps, if any, in relation to the management of the society may be taken after thepublication of the order under sub-section (1).

Telecom Regulatory Authority of India Act, 1997 (24 of 1997) Section 6

Title: Powers of Chairperson and Vice-chairperson

State: Central

Year: 1997

(1) The Chairperson shall have powers of general superintendence and directions in the conduct of the affairs of the Authority and he shall, in addition to presiding over the meetings of the Authority, exercise and discharge such powers and functions of the Authority and shall discharge such other powers and functions as may be prescribed. (2) The Central Government may appoint one of the members to be a Vice-Chairperson of the Authority who shall exercise and discharge such powers and functions of the Chairperson as may be prescribed or as may be delegated to him by the Authority.

National Environment Appellate Authority Act, 1997 Section 6

Title: Vice-chairperson to Act as Chairperson or to Discharge His Functions in Certain Circumstances

State: Central

Year: 1997

(1) In the event of the occurrence of any vacancy in the office of the Chairperson by reason of his death, resignation or otherwise, the Vice-Chairperson shall act as the Chairperson until the date on which a new Chairperson appointed in accordance with the provisions of this Act to fill such vacancy enters upon his office. (2) When the Chairperson is unable to discharge his functions owing to absence, illness or any other cause, the Vice-Chairperson or, as the case may be, such one of the Member as the Central Government may, by notification, authorise in this behalf, shall discharge the functions of the Chairperson until the date on which the Chairperson resumes his duties.
